I have bought and sold many things on craigslist. The main issue I've had is as soon as the ad is up, someone sends me a reply saying "please to reply to me at xxx.gmail.com address because I don't check my emails." That's bull. They just want your email address for nefarious purposes. I always state that I will use CL reply mail only and I won't reply to requests to email you. Sometimes I reply to an ad and get no response - that's kind of typical and I figure it's sold and they just haven't taken the ad down.

I tell people if they are really interested, reply back with their phone number and I'll text them. Most people who are serious buyers do that and I haven't had any issues.
